Up here there is a 2013 Auto 5.0 that has ARH Longtubes, catted H pipe into a 3" exhaust, Boss heads, Comp Stage 3 cams tuned to use all 50 degrees of VCT and valve timing, Cobra Jet Intake, CJ throttle body and intake tube, 3.31 gears, 3800 stall, suspension mods and an aluminum DS.
Fairly extensive mods, but in 1500 foot DA, I personally watched it run 10.95 @ 123 mph at 3700lbs. Stock trans and long block. Put down 495 whp and 403 wtq. Still gets 25 mpg on the highway and sounds like a prostock motor at full power. Not bad for a stock displacement, N/A 5.0 |

A Stock ZL1 is much quicker than a 5.0 However, I don't recall you ever modding your 5.0 so you don't really know how hard a bolt-on 5.0 pulls. The question the OP posted wasn't a bolt-on ZL1 Vs. a Bolt-on 5.0. However, it doesn't take engine work in a 5.0 to go 10's. There are a lot of guys that have been forward on their mods and have never opened their motors. Sure, they've got aggressive stalls, are running race gas or E85 and have a good amount of weight reduction. Depends on the setup. Setups similar to mine with some suspension and a set of Drag Radials are low-mid 11's @ 118-121 depending on temps/driver and track prep full weight.
